A vessel originally contained 0.200 mol iodine monobromide (IBr), 0.0010 mol I2, and 0.0010 mol Br2. The equilibrium constant Kc for the reaction
I2(g) + Br2(g)= 2IB1(g)

is 1.2 × 102 at 150oC. What is the direction (forward or reverse) needed to attain equilibrium at 150oC?
